"Manatee Crossroads," Limited Edition Bronze Sculpture
This mother and calf sculpture by noted artist Simon Morris capture the beauty and slow moving grace of these gentle creatures.
Simon's limited edition bronze sculptures are displayed in private and corporate collections throughout the world. His nine-foot-tall "Emerald Princess" mermaid sculpture in British Columbia has become a world famous icon and attracts divers from around the globe, and his work has been chosen for many awards. "Ocean Futures," unveiled by Jacques-Yves Cousteau in New Orleans, was auctioned to raise funds for the Cousteau Society. Simon's art has also been represented by P.A.D.I.'s Project A.W.A.R.E. Foundation to raise funds for deserving environmental concerns.
Simon is generously donating 15% from the sale of each Manatee Crossroads sculpture to Save the Manatee Club for manatee protection efforts. Click on the Amazon link at left to purchase the sculpture.
